    Summary of Position
    Reporting to the General Manager, this position supports coordinating all aspects of day-to-day operations, employee-related matters, and guests service for the dining hall.

    This is an essential staff position in Hospitality Services and is necessary for food production/service operations through weather or other emergency conditions.

    The University of New Hampshire is an R1 Carnegie classification research institution providing comprehensive, high-quality undergraduate and graduate programs of distinction. UNH is located in Durham on a 188-acre campus, 60 miles north of Boston and 8 miles from the Atlantic coast and is convenient to New Hampshire's lakes and mountains. There is a student enrollment of 13,000 students, with a full-time faculty of over 600, offering 90 undergraduate and more than 70 graduate programs.     Duties / Responsibilities



    Job Duties

    Duty/Responsibility
    Daily management and supervision of all operating, adjunct and student staff, including develop and communicate all schedules (semester, daily, J-Term and summer); assign staff roles and duties; direct supervisors on menu changes; ensure customer service and food quality standards are met or exceeded through verbal communication, observation, and food tasting over meal periods; address guest concerns and equipment issues; and update staff of up to the minute changes.

    Duty/Responsibility
    Schedule and participate in student employee interviews, hiring, and onboarding. Complete hiring paperwork, including hiring tickets, I-9 forms, and coordination of international students with OISS. Hiring is ongoing throughout the year to ensure necessary staffing levels are met student employees). Participate in OS and adjunct interviews and hiring decisions. Utilize the timekeeping software for timecard approvals and for correction of timecard errors. Assist in planning and executing Hospitality and Campus Services job fairs throughout the year.

    Duty/Responsibility
    Develop and maintain a high performing team through coaching and training. Create training materials and standard operating procedures for operating, adjunct and student employees. Keep track of all training and adjust as necessary to ensure the highest level of quality, service, safety, and sanitation.

    Duty/Responsibility
    Ensure that policies and procedures are being followed. Manage, coach, and discipline all staff. Assign, oversee, and participate in annual performance reviews.

    Duty/Responsibility
    Manage daily and weekly labor hours utilizing the Adjunct/Student Labor tool. Assist in food cost and waste management to meet budget requirements and sustainability targets. Oversee cleaning and housekeeping activities to ensure that the highest sanitation and safety standards are met.Other duties/projects as assigned. Based on business needs, position will be required to assist with production and service requirements, as necessary.
